Capacity note for the Quillmere 4.2 release: encoding detection on uploaded text files is CPU-bound, not I/O-bound. The Harbinger sniffer samples a prefix of each file, so cost scales with upload count rather than size. At projected volumes we need two extra detector workers per region; beyond that, raising the sample window buys accuracy but costs latency. The knobs we plan to ship, pending your sign-off, are set out below.

tuning table, faduf-baduf:
PRIORITIES = {
    "ulavan": 191,
    "silys": 750,
    "goriel": 238,
    "kelmir": 66,
    "wendor": 432,
}

## Runbook: Pellwick Consent Banner Rollout

Support team: the new consent banner ships to 10% of tenants per day. If a customer reports the banner looping or reappearing after acceptance, first confirm their tenant is in the active cohort, then check whether their preference record shows a stale schema version. Do not clear preferences manually; escalate to the privacy on-call instead. All rollout cohorts are pinned to the build shown directly below.

pipeline stamp: htk9_ce63042d9

## Formula sandbox tuning

User-supplied formulas in Gridmoor execute inside a restricted interpreter with hard ceilings on time, memory, and call depth. Reviewers should confirm any change to these ceilings is justified in the PR description, since raising them widens the abuse surface. Defaults were chosen from production traces. The current limits are as follows.

limits module of tafog-fawip:
WEIGHTS = {
    "julix": 57,
    "lamys": 992,
    "kasvan": 209,
    "quenok": 750,
    "alddor": 259,
    "oliath": 1009,
    "wenix": 815,
}